About Us

Sahara Rural Development Welfare Society (SRDWS)

SRDWS actively addresses pollution, promotes sustainable farming practices, nurtures Mother Earth without chemicals, advocates for organic and green initiatives, and fosters farmer economic growth.

Founded in 2009, Sahara Rural Development Welfare Society is committed to women's empowerment. We achieve this through skill-building initiatives such as tailoring, computer operations, beautician training, and more. Our programs also focus on raising awareness and ensuring safety for women.

National Lok Adalat

The National Lok Adalat held on July 10, 2021, at the Junior Civil Judge Court in Nidmanoor successfully concluded with the resolution of 429 cases. The event was overseen by Junior Civil Judge Purshotham Rao Garu, Advocate China Veeraiah Garu along with the participation of the police and the public.
